    Our Company

    • Global provider of hydrogen fuel cells and water electrolysis products and services

    • Incorporated in 1995 [NASDAQ: HYGS; TSX: HYG]

    • 160 full time employees

    • Headquartered in Canada with European facilities in Germany and Belgium

    • 181 patents and patent applications

    • More than 2,000 products deployed in 100 countries worldwide

    • Manufacturing facilities are ISO 9001 audited

  • Hydrogenics and Enbridge are developing the first Power-to-Gas

    project in North America to provide grid services to the IESO

    P2G Project Highlights Key Objectives

    • 2MW capacity

    • Ancillary Service Provider to

    IESO under commercial contract

    • Hydrogenics next generation

    PEM MW-scale electrolyser

    • Located in Greater Toronto Area

    • Commissioned Spring 2017

    • In collaboration with the

    Canadian Gas Association

    • Shared objective with IESO to

    assess the capabilities of a

    Power-to-Gas energy storage

    facility for providing grid

    services—learning pilot

    • Develop 5MW Module

    Architecture

    • First Power-to-Gas reference

    site in North America

    2MW Ontario Power-to-Gas Project
